Yep, the LECTRIC XP 3.0 electric bike is foldable, which is super handy if you need to stash it in a tight spot or take it on the bus or train. From what the manufacturer says, this folding feature really stands out, especially if you're commuting or buzzing around the city.

Besides folding up nicely, it's got some impressive specs too. It's a Class 3 eBike, so you can hit up to 28 mph with pedal assist or 20 mph if you're just using the throttle. That's pretty great if you want something that’s both fast and versatile, whether you're rushing to work or just enjoying a chill ride.

Also, based on what we've found, it comes with five different pedal-assist levels. These let you tweak your ride to match the terrain and your comfort, which is really helpful if you're navigating different areas of the city. The battery can last up to 65 miles on a charge, which is awesome for longer trips without worrying about running out of juice.

Just a heads up, though—our research shows that the range can vary depending on factors like the terrain, your weight, and how much assist you're using. Some people have mentioned that getting used to the setup initially can be a bit tricky, and there have been some concerns about build quality in earlier feedback.

Still, if you're after a foldable eBike that's packed with features and offers good speed and flexibility for its price, the LECTRIC XP 3.0 is worth considering.
